Secure TV Enclosure for Enhanced Patient Security

In healthcare settings, patient well-being is paramount. A crucial aspect of this is safeguarding patients from potential harm caused by unauthorized interaction with medical equipment. To address this concern, a protective TV enclosure has emerged as a vital solution. This specialized enclosure offers a physical barrier between patients and the television screen, effectively minimizing the risk of injury or interruption.

The enclosure is designed with durable materials to withstand potential impact, ensuring long-lasting protection. Furthermore, it features a secure latching mechanism that prevents unauthorized entry. Consequently, the protective TV enclosure plays a significant role in creating a safer and more reliable environment for patients within healthcare facilities.

Medical-Grade Secure Television Housing

In healthcare environments, resident privacy is paramount. A sturdy hospital-grade secure television housing is indispensable to maintain this standard of safeguarding. These housings are designed with strength in mind, capable of withstanding rough handling.

They also incorporate state-of-the-art locking mechanisms to prevent unauthorized access. Moreover, hospital-grade secure television housings are often constructed with sanitary finishes to help minimize the risk ofdisease transmission.
